Cooking Up some Fun!

8/22/2014

0 Comments

 
I have savored the recipes all week. Last Saturday, Chef Elizabeth Skipper, from The Everyday Epicure, came to the shop for our fifth drop-in cooking demo. I'm fascinated by the range of ability each guest chef has to offer. Elizabeth concentrated on appetizers and the results were stunning!

The day began with a bit of a struggle. Deb and I had agreed to meet at 8:45 to prep the shop before opening. She was picking up balloons and it never occurred to either of us that the Dollar Store wouldn't open until 9:30. I became panicked when she didn't arrive until 9:45 but with the help of our landlords, the tent went up, the tables were set and everything came together.

As to the food? Chef Skipper cooked up Sicilian Chicken tidbits with mint sauce, Bruschetta, and fried Sage Leaves.
